Tell me I'm paranoid. TF/F flexible brake pipes are identical aren't they?
Only asking as F Goodrich kits are available, but not for TF. Otherwise will have to make my own up!

According to the EPC, there are two hoses listed - one for cars pre-2D 600100, and those after this VIN.

However, I suspect that they aren't that different - can anyone comment?

Hoses on order this am. Let you know the outcome. It's not fatal if the rears are a bit short, as the hose is cheaper than the fittings, and a longer length can be fitted.
Jerry Herbert

Got a set of Mike Satur Goodridge hoses on now. No problems at all. The four hoses supplied were the same, F rear ones I think. Bit of cling film and elastic band on the master cylinder, swop over, gravity bleed, done in no time!!
The old TF fronts were about 30cm, rears 34cm if any help.
